Time the record covers

At least 94 million years on record.

The record covers at least 121.4 Mya to 27.3 Mya. No occurrence read is dated outside 125.77 Mya to 23.04 Mya.

51 occurrences of Ectobiidae on record, most of them in the Eocene. The Paleobiology Database records this as a living group, and the chart stops with its fossils rather than at the present. Bar height is expected occurrences, not a count: each fossil is spread across the span it is dated to, so a tall narrow bar means tight dating and a low wide one means loose.
